应用LZHUF算法对嵌入式针织系统控制数据压缩  被引量:1

Data compression of embedded knitting system based on LZHUF algorithm

在线阅读下载全文

作  者:朱耀麟[1,2] 刁先举 张团善[3] 高术森 乔辉[3] 

机构地区:[1]西安工程大学电子信息学院,陕西西安710048 [2]西北工业大学电子信息学院,陕西西安710072 [3]西安工程大学机电工程学院,陕西西安710048

出  处:《纺织学报》2018年第3期148-153,共6页Journal of Textile Research

基  金:国家科技部攻关项目(2012BAF13800);陕西省科技厅项目(2016KW-043;2016GY-047);陕西省教育厅自然科学基金项目(15JK1320);中国纺织工业联合会科技项目指导性计划项目(2016029)

摘  要:为解决针织物控制数据量大,花型数据重复性高,且要求无损传输等问题,提出了一种针织控制数据压缩的LZHUF算法,给出了算法实现流程。利用LZSS算法对待压缩织物数据同时编码,再对输出的字符使用频率的高低进行动态哈夫曼编码。该算法可移植到嵌入式平台,对织物数据解压缩。实验结果显示,该算法可在嵌入式针织系统中无损解压缩织物数据,运行效率较高,压缩率相对传统串表压缩算法,明显提高5%以上,说明该算法具有较高的压缩率,算法复杂度低,可在存储空间和内存空间有限的嵌入式针织控制系统中无损还原织物控制数据;同时该算法可作为纺织CAD的数据压缩算法。In order to solve problems of big volume of the knitted fabric control data,high reproducibility of pattern data and non-destructive transmission,a knitting control data compression algorithm was presented. The realization algorithm process was given. LZSS was used to encode the compressed fabric data simultaneously,and then dynamic Huffman coding was carried out according to the application frequency of output characters. The algorithm could be transplanted to the embedded platform to achieve the decompression of fabric data. The experimental results show that the algorithm can compress the fabric data in the embedded knitting system,and the algorithm is more efficient. Compared with the conventional Lemple-Ziv-Welch encoding( LZW) algorithm,the compression ratio is improved obviously by more than 5%. It is proved that the algorithm has high compression ratio and low complexity,and can reduce the fabric control data in the embedded knitting control system with limited storage space and memory space. At the same time,the algorithm can be used as a data compression algorithm for textile CAD.

关 键 词:数据压缩算法 织物控制数据 压缩率 嵌入式针织系统 

分 类 号:TP312[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象